Message type: E = Error
Message class: CA_TTE - TTE Messages
Message number: 519
Message text: Jurisdiction code too short acccording to jurisdiction code structure &

- Jurisdiction code too short acccording to jurisdiction code structure & ?The SAP error message CA_TTE519, which states "Jurisdiction code too short according to jurisdiction code structure," typically occurs when the jurisdiction code being used in a transaction or configuration does not meet the required length or format as defined in the system settings.
Cause:
- Jurisdiction Code Length: The jurisdiction code you are trying to use is shorter than the minimum length defined in the jurisdiction code structure settings.
- Configuration Issues: The jurisdiction code structure may not be properly configured in the system, leading to discrepancies between the expected and actual code lengths.
- Data Entry Error: There may be a typographical error or oversight when entering the jurisdiction code.
Solution:
Check Jurisdiction Code Structure:
- Go to the configuration settings for jurisdiction codes in your SAP system. This can typically be found in the customizing (SPRO) settings under the relevant module (e.g., Financial Accounting).
- Verify the defined structure for jurisdiction codes, including the minimum and maximum lengths.
Correct the Jurisdiction Code:
- Ensure that the jurisdiction code you are entering meets the required length and format. If it is too short, modify it to comply with the defined structure.
- If you are unsure of the correct code, consult with your compliance or tax department to obtain the appropriate jurisdiction code.
Update Configuration if Necessary:
- If the jurisdiction code structure needs to be adjusted (for example, if the business requirements have changed), you may need to update the configuration settings. This should be done with caution and typically requires appropriate authorization.
Testing:
- After making the necessary changes, test the transaction again to ensure that the error is resolved.
Related Information:
If the issue persists after following these steps, it may be beneficial to consult with your SAP support team or a technical consultant who can provide further assistance.
